    We loved Ávila, the city walls are the main attraction, plus...

    We loved Ávila, the city walls are the main attraction, plus there are monasteries and churches to visit. The walled city is easy for waking around. There are many restaurants with outdoor eating areas. The one thing to be aware of is that the town more or less closes down from 2:00 until about 5:00. This is common in Spain but may surprise visitors who are not aware of “siesta.” That was when we returned to the Parador for snacks in the club room and terrace. I will mention that the food in the Parador restaurant was delicious and they had vegetarian options right in the menu without me having to ask, which I really appreciated!

    Great view of the Sierra de Gredos and starting place to...

    Great view of the Sierra de Gredos and starting place to drive to the Plataforma de Gredos. This is an easy way to experience high mountain landscape without having to climb yourself. If you wander off the beaten track (avoid Laguna Grande), you will likely see large herds of ibexes. La Galana is a Slow Food restaurant with great food.

    On balance, I'm not so sure Avila was the right choice for...

    On balance, I'm not so sure Avila was the right choice for me. It isn't easy to get to - however you do it, it takes three trains from Madrid airport. The last one - from Madrid Principe Pio - takes over 90 minutes. Even so, Avila seems to be a place for day trips, so the lunchtime crowd is busy, but the place is a ghost town at night, with a lot of restaurants not even open (at least when we were there in a May midweek). Restaurants are curiously not geared to tourism - English speaking staff and English menus are the exception (and just forget it if you want German or French). I would contrast Avila unfavourably with Santiago del Compostella, which is ostensibly similar but is easier to reach, has far more hospitality choices and is much more tourist friendly.
